  • WhatsApp

    Category: - WhatsApp Messenger, or simply WhatsApp, is a freeware, cross-platform, encrypted, centralized instant messaging (IM) service and voice-over-IP (VoIP) service owned by American company Meta Platforms. It allows users to send text messages and voice messages, make voice and video calls, and share images, documents, user locations, and other content.

Notable Elements (according to Gemini Flash Lite 2.0)

Milestones

  • Founded in 2009 by Jan Koum and Brian Acton.
  • Acquired by Facebook (now Meta Platforms) in 2014 for approximately $19 billion.
  • Reached 1 billion monthly active users in 2016.
  • Implemented end-to-end encryption by default for all communications in 2016.
  • Launched WhatsApp Business API and app in 2018.
  • Reached over 2 billion users globally in 2020.

Cultural Impact: WhatsApp has become ubiquitous in many parts of the world, especially in developing countries, replacing traditional SMS and even calls in daily communication. It has fostered communities, facilitated family communication across borders, and become a crucial tool for small businesses. Its end-to-end encryption has also raised awareness about privacy, though its ownership by Facebook has led to some skepticism.
